Our Process
How we work with you
A great financial plan begins with truly understanding you. Our process is intentionally personal, collaborative, and built to help you feel informed—not rushed.
1. Getting to Know You
Before we meet, we’ll send you a secure online form where you can share key details about your life. Your family, your income, your goals, and your financial picture. This gives us the context to make your first meeting meaningful and efficient.
2. The First Conversation (No paperwork, just people)
Your first meeting with us is focused almost entirely on who you are as a person or family.
We talk far less about investments and far more about:
Your values and priorities
How you think and feel about money
Your biggest goals, worries, and opportunities
Your long-term vision for family, legacy, and lifestyle
This is a no-pressure conversation. There are no commitments, no decisions to make, and no signatures required. The goal is simply to learn whether we may be a good fit for each other.
3. Your Preliminary Financial Plan
After the meeting, our team takes everything you shared, both in conversation and in your initial form, and begins drafting a preliminary financial plan. This plan provides a first look at:
Your financial strengths
Areas that may need attention
Potential strategies to move closer to your goals
This is a framework, not a final blueprint. We build it knowing your life is dynamic and changes are always possible.
4. The Second Meeting & Next Steps
In our second conversation, we present your preliminary plan and walk through each component together. You’ll have the chance to react, ask questions, suggest adjustments, and tell us where you want deeper analysis.
If the relationship feels right for both sides, we’ll complete the necessary paperwork to formally begin working together.
Your plan will always remain flexible.
As life changes, your financial plan should evolve with it, and we’ll be there every step of the way.
